Output afe33a973e17d07da6828433861c3225c5187077720ddfc908f3a2556bf8121d:1

value
2424807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a634078bc3c9391a8748bc95ebb800bd5e3b6bd OP_EQUAL
address
371k1os7XLQyreK1dB7TpYhKAeGqYt9e6P
transaction
afe33a973e17d07da6828433861c3225c5187077720ddfc908f3a2556bf8121d
spent
true